366/**
367 * fc_fcp_can_queue_ramp_down() - reduces can_queue
368 * @lport: lport to reduce can_queue
369 *
370 * If we are getting memory allocation failures, then we may
371 * be trying to execute too many commands. We let the running
372 * commands complete or timeout, then try again with a reduced
373 * can_queue. Eventually we will hit the point where we run
374 * on all reserved structs.
375 *
376 * Locking notes: Called with Scsi_Host lock held
377 */
378static void fc_fcp_can_queue_ramp_down(struct fc_lport *lport)
379{
380	struct fc_fcp_internal *si = fc_get_scsi_internal(lport);
381	int can_queue;
382
383	if (si->last_can_queue_ramp_down_time &&
384	    (time_before(jiffies, si->last_can_queue_ramp_down_time +
385			 FC_CAN_QUEUE_PERIOD)))
386		return;
387
388	si->last_can_queue_ramp_down_time = jiffies;
389
390	can_queue = lport->host->can_queue;
391	can_queue >>= 1;
392	if (!can_queue)
393		can_queue = 1;
394	lport->host->can_queue = can_queue;
395	shost_printk(KERN_ERR, lport->host, "libfc: Could not allocate frame.\n"
396		     "Reducing can_queue to %d.\n", can_queue);
397}

1350/**
1351 * fc_fcp_timeout() - Handler for fcp_pkt timeouts
1352 * @data: The FCP packet that has timed out
1353 *
1354 * If REC is supported then just issue it and return. The REC exchange will
1355 * complete or time out and recovery can continue at that point. Otherwise,
1356 * if the response has been received without all the data it has been
1357 * ER_TIMEOUT since the response was received. If the response has not been
1358 * received we see if data was received recently. If it has been then we
1359 * continue waiting, otherwise, we abort the command.
1360 */
1361static void fc_fcp_timeout(unsigned long data)
1362{
1363	struct fc_fcp_pkt *fsp = (struct fc_fcp_pkt *)data;
1364	struct fc_rport *rport = fsp->rport;
1365	struct fc_rport_libfc_priv *rpriv = rport->dd_data;
1366
1367	if (fc_fcp_lock_pkt(fsp))
1368		return;
1369
1370	if (fsp->cdb_cmd.fc_tm_flags)
1371		goto unlock;
1372
1373	fsp->state |= FC_SRB_FCP_PROCESSING_TMO;
1374
1375	if (rpriv->flags & FC_RP_FLAGS_REC_SUPPORTED)
1376		fc_fcp_rec(fsp);
1377	else if (fsp->state & FC_SRB_RCV_STATUS)
1378		fc_fcp_complete_locked(fsp);
1379	else
1380		fc_fcp_recovery(fsp, FC_TIMED_OUT);
1381	fsp->state &= ~FC_SRB_FCP_PROCESSING_TMO;
1382unlock:
1383	fc_fcp_unlock_pkt(fsp);
1384}

1431/**
1432 * fc_fcp_rec_resp() - Handler for REC ELS responses
1433 * @seq: The sequence the response is on
1434 * @fp:	 The response frame
1435 * @arg: The FCP packet the response is on
1436 *
1437 * If the response is a reject then the scsi layer will handle
1438 * the timeout. If the response is a LS_ACC then if the I/O was not completed
1439 * set the timeout and return. If the I/O was completed then complete the
1440 * exchange and tell the SCSI layer.
1441 */
1442static void fc_fcp_rec_resp(struct fc_seq *seq, struct fc_frame *fp, void *arg)
1443{
1444	struct fc_fcp_pkt *fsp = (struct fc_fcp_pkt *)arg;
1445	struct fc_els_rec_acc *recp;
1446	struct fc_els_ls_rjt *rjt;
1447	u32 e_stat;
1448	u8 opcode;
1449	u32 offset;
1450	enum dma_data_direction data_dir;
1451	enum fc_rctl r_ctl;
1452	struct fc_rport_libfc_priv *rpriv;
1453
1454	if (IS_ERR(fp)) {
1455		fc_fcp_rec_error(fsp, fp);
1456		return;
1457	}
1458
1459	if (fc_fcp_lock_pkt(fsp))
1460		goto out;
1461
1462	fsp->recov_retry = 0;
1463	opcode = fc_frame_payload_op(fp);
1464	if (opcode == ELS_LS_RJT) {
1465		rjt = fc_frame_payload_get(fp, sizeof(*rjt));
1466		switch (rjt->er_reason) {
1467		default:
1468			FC_FCP_DBG(fsp, "device %x unexpected REC reject "
1469				   "reason %d expl %d\n",
1470				   fsp->rport->port_id, rjt->er_reason,
1471				   rjt->er_explan);
1472			/* fall through */
1473		case ELS_RJT_UNSUP:
1474			FC_FCP_DBG(fsp, "device does not support REC\n");
1475			rpriv = fsp->rport->dd_data;
1476			/*
1477			 * if we do not spport RECs or got some bogus
1478			 * reason then resetup timer so we check for
1479			 * making progress.
1480			 */
1481			rpriv->flags &= ~FC_RP_FLAGS_REC_SUPPORTED;
1482			break;
1483		case ELS_RJT_LOGIC:
1484		case ELS_RJT_UNAB:
1485			/*
1486			 * If no data transfer, the command frame got dropped
1487			 * so we just retry.  If data was transferred, we
1488			 * lost the response but the target has no record,
1489			 * so we abort and retry.
1490			 */
1491			if (rjt->er_explan == ELS_EXPL_OXID_RXID &&
1492			    fsp->xfer_len == 0) {
1493				fc_fcp_retry_cmd(fsp);
1494				break;
1495			}
1496			fc_fcp_recovery(fsp, FC_ERROR);
1497			break;
1498		}
1499	} else if (opcode == ELS_LS_ACC) {
1500		if (fsp->state & FC_SRB_ABORTED)
1501			goto unlock_out;
1502
1503		data_dir = fsp->cmd->sc_data_direction;
1504		recp = fc_frame_payload_get(fp, sizeof(*recp));
1505		offset = ntohl(recp->reca_fc4value);
1506		e_stat = ntohl(recp->reca_e_stat);
1507
1508		if (e_stat & ESB_ST_COMPLETE) {
1509
1510			/*
1511			 * The exchange is complete.
1512			 *
1513			 * For output, we must've lost the response.
1514			 * For input, all data must've been sent.
1515			 * We lost may have lost the response
1516			 * (and a confirmation was requested) and maybe
1517			 * some data.
1518			 *
1519			 * If all data received, send SRR
1520			 * asking for response.	 If partial data received,
1521			 * or gaps, SRR requests data at start of gap.
1522			 * Recovery via SRR relies on in-order-delivery.
1523			 */
1524			if (data_dir == DMA_TO_DEVICE) {
1525				r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_CMD_STATUS;
1526			} else if (fsp->xfer_contig_end == offset) {
1527				r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_CMD_STATUS;
1528			} else {
1529				offset = fsp->xfer_contig_end;
1530				r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_SOL_DATA;
1531			}
1532			fc_fcp_srr(fsp, r_ctl, offset);
1533		} else if (e_stat & ESB_ST_SEQ_INIT) {
1534			unsigned int rec_tov = get_fsp_rec_tov(fsp);
1535			/*
1536			 * The remote port has the initiative, so just
1537			 * keep waiting for it to complete.
1538			 */
1539			fc_fcp_timer_set(fsp, rec_tov);
1540		} else {
1541
1542			/*
1543			 * The exchange is incomplete, we have seq. initiative.
1544			 * Lost response with requested confirmation,
1545			 * lost confirmation, lost transfer ready or
1546			 * lost write data.
1547			 *
1548			 * For output, if not all data was received, ask
1549			 * for transfer ready to be repeated.
1550			 *
1551			 * If we received or sent all the data, send SRR to
1552			 * request response.
1553			 *
1554			 * If we lost a response, we may have lost some read
1555			 * data as well.
1556			 */
1557			r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_SOL_DATA;
1558			if (data_dir == DMA_TO_DEVICE) {
1559				r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_CMD_STATUS;
1560				if (offset < fsp->data_len)
1561					r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_DATA_DESC;
1562			} else if (offset == fsp->xfer_contig_end) {
1563				r_ctl = FC_RCTL_DD_CMD_STATUS;
1564			} else if (fsp->xfer_contig_end < offset) {
1565				offset = fsp->xfer_contig_end;
1566			}
1567			fc_fcp_srr(fsp, r_ctl, offset);
1568		}
1569	}
1570unlock_out:
1571	fc_fcp_unlock_pkt(fsp);
1572out:
1573	fc_fcp_pkt_release(fsp);	/* drop hold for outstanding REC */
1574	fc_frame_free(fp);
1575}
